PureCycle Technologies Inc. has entered into a Construction Progress Agreement $(CPA)$ with the Development Authority of Augusta, Georgia (AEDA), revising and supplementing the construction milestones and related obligations for its second-generation polypropylene recycling facility in Augusta, Georgia. Under the CPA, PureCycle will make aggregate cash payments of $500,000 to AEDA in two equal installments, with the first payment expected by January 9, 2026. The company has also waived its right to lease an additional approximately 50 acres beyond the initial site. The agreement establishes a revised construction timeline with milestone targets extending through commissioning, startup, and full production, including a requirement to start construction no later than March 2028. The CPA also includes penalties and termination rights for AEDA if certain milestones are not met.
